色々意見はあると思われるが、現状以下の組み合わせが良さそう(更新: 2019/5/30)。
- 環境:
- Macの場合は、Homebrew → Pyenv → Anacondaという順でインストールするのが良い。(http://qiita.com/oct_itmt/items/2d066801a7464a676994)
- IDE/Editor: Visual Studio Codeが設定がほとんど不要,動作が軽く,機能も充実して良い。
- ライブラリ:
- 表データ読み込み・操作: Pandas
- 数値計算・画像処理: Numpy, SciPy
- プロット: Matplotlib, Seaborn
- データ処理ジョブの依存性管理: Luigi